What a prebuilt mechanical keyboard is best for
A prebuilt mechanical keyboard is the easiest way to get mechanical switch feel without assembling parts yourself. You buy it ready to use, plug it in or pair it, and start typing. Start with the buyer scenario, not the spec sheet
The wrong keyboard often looks great on paper and feels wrong on the desk. Before comparing switches or materials, decide what problem the keyboard is supposed to solve.
If you want an easier first mechanical keyboard
A prebuilt model is usually the safest entry point if you are moving from a laptop keyboard or a standard membrane board. You can learn what you like in real use before diving into keycap sets, sound tuning, or switch films. That matters because preferences in keyboards are surprisingly personal.
For beginners, it usually makes sense to prioritize a familiar layout, decent build quality, and a switch type that is not too extreme. A board that is too loud, too tall, or too compact can make the first experience feel more like a trade-off than an upgrade.
If you need one keyboard for work and play
Mixed-use buyers should think about balance. A responsive switch can help in games, but a comfortable layout and stable typing platform matter more if you spend hours writing, coding, or handling spreadsheets. A prebuilt keyboard with a sensible middle-of-the-road switch and useful shortcut layers can serve both roles well.
If you care about a cleaner desk setup
Some shoppers simply want a keyboard that looks and feels more intentional than a basic office model. In that case, case material, colorway, keycap profile, and cable setup can matter as much as the switches. A prebuilt board can be the most practical route to a polished desktop without turning your purchase into a hobby project.

Material and construction details worth paying attention to
For a prebuilt mechanical keyboard, materials affect more than looks. They influence sound, weight, stability, and how premium the board feels during long sessions.
Case material
Most buyers will choose between plastic and metal cases, though some keyboards combine both. Plastic cases are usually lighter and easier to move. They can be perfectly fine for office or home use, especially if you value portability. Metal cases often feel denser and more solid on the desk, but that does not automatically make them better. A well-designed plastic keyboard can be more comfortable and quieter than a hollow-feeling metal one.
Keycaps
Keycap material matters because it affects texture and long-term wear. PBT keycaps are often preferred for a drier, more textured feel, while ABS keycaps can feel smoother and sometimes sound different. Neither is universally better. The better choice depends on whether you care more about grip, sound, shine resistance, or the specific profile used.
Keycap profile also affects typing comfort. Taller, sculpted profiles can feel traditional and precise, while lower profiles may feel faster or easier to adapt to. If you are sensitive to wrist position or travel distance, profile is worth more attention than it usually gets.
Stabilizers
Stabilizers help larger keys like the spacebar, Enter key, and Shift key feel even. On many prebuilt keyboards, stabilizer quality is an overlooked difference between a board that sounds refined and one that feels rattly. Buyers often focus on switches and ignore stabilizers, but that is a mistake. If those bigger keys sound loose or uneven, the whole board can feel less polished.
Switch choice: where most of the feel comes from
The switch is the heart of any mechanical keyboard. In a prebuilt model, switch selection often defines whether the board feels light, tactile, quiet, or crisp.
Linear switches
Linear switches move smoothly from top to bottom without a tactile bump. They are often chosen for gaming and for users who like a clean, consistent keystroke. Some people also prefer them because they can sound softer and feel less busy under the fingers.
Tactile switches
Tactile switches give a noticeable bump during the press. Many typists like that feedback because it helps confirm when a key has been actuated. Tactile boards are often a strong choice if you do a lot of writing and want a more defined typing feel without going all the way to a clicky switch.
Clicky switches
Clicky switches add an audible click along with tactile feedback. Some users love the classic sound and pronounced response, but they are not ideal in every setting. Shared offices, late-night work sessions, and quiet households may call for something less outspoken.
A useful rule: decide first whether you prefer smooth, tactile, or clicky feedback, then choose the exact switch afterward. Too many shoppers reverse that order and end up with a keyboard that looks appealing but does not match their typing style.
Layout matters more than many first-time buyers expect
Keyboard layout affects desk space, hand movement, and daily convenience. A prebuilt mechanical keyboard can be easy to live with or awkward, depending on the layout you choose.
Full-size
Best if you use a number pad often. Accountants, spreadsheet-heavy users, and some office workers may prefer the extra keys. The trade-off is footprint. Full-size boards take more room and can push your mouse farther to the side.
Tenkeyless
A tenkeyless board removes the number pad while keeping the main typing section and function row. It is a popular compromise for people who want more desk space without giving up standard keys.
Compact layouts
Smaller layouts save space and can look cleaner, but they usually rely more on function layers and shortcuts. That is not inherently bad, but it does require a short learning curve. If you use arrow keys, navigation keys, or media controls constantly, make sure the layout supports those habits comfortably.
An overlooked consideration: desk size and mouse travel matter. A smaller keyboard can improve ergonomics simply by bringing your mouse closer to your body. For some users, that is a bigger benefit than shaving a few extra keys.
Wired, wireless, or both?
Connection type is another practical choice that shapes how the keyboard fits your space.
Wired keyboards are straightforward, reliable, and usually the simplest option if you sit at one desk most of the time. They remove battery management from the equation and can be easier for users who want a consistent setup. wireless vs wired keyboard basics offers more detail on this point.
Wireless keyboards are useful if you value a cleaner desk, switch between devices, or move your keyboard often. The trade-off is charging or battery replacement, plus the need to pay attention to connection behavior and latency expectations.
Some prebuilt models offer both wired and wireless use. That flexibility is attractive, but it is worth asking whether you will actually use it. A dual-mode board is only a true advantage if you plan to change your setup often or want the option to keep typing while charging.
Hot-swappable versus fixed switch sockets
Hot-swap support is one of the most practical upgrade features in a prebuilt mechanical keyboard. It lets you change switches without soldering.
If you are curious about different switch types or think you may want to replace a few switches later, hot-swappable sockets can extend the useful life of a keyboard. They also reduce the risk of feeling locked into your first choice.
Fixed-socket boards can still be excellent, especially if you already know what you like. They may feel more straightforward and sometimes cost less. The limitation is flexibility. If you later decide you want a different feel, the upgrade path is narrower.
Sound profile: useful, but easy to overemphasize
Keyboard sound is a real part of the typing experience, but it should not be the only deciding factor. A board that sounds good in a product video may still feel poor in daily use.
Sound depends on several things working together: switch type, case material, plate material, stabilizers, keycaps, and the desk surface underneath. A heavier board may sound deeper. A lighter plastic board may sound brighter or more hollow. Some users prefer a muted profile, while others like a crisp, lively response.
The practical question is whether the sound suits your environment. If you share a space, audio profile can matter more than online descriptions of “thock” or “clack.” Those terms are useful shorthand, but they are not a substitute for matching the keyboard to your setting.

Common mistakes buyers make
A good prebuilt mechanical keyboard is not just the one with the best materials. It is the one that fits the way you work.
- Choosing by looks alone: a beautiful board can still have the wrong layout or switch type.
- Ignoring desk space: especially important for full-size boards and large mouse movements.
- Underestimating noise: clicky or bright boards may be disruptive in shared environments.
- Overvaluing RGB: lighting can be fun, but it should not overshadow ergonomics and build quality.
- Skipping upgrade potential: hot-swap support can make a big difference later.
- Assuming all prebuilt boards feel premium: case hollowing, stabilizer quality, and keycap finish vary widely.
The biggest mistake is probably assuming you can fix every issue later. Some flaws are easy to live with, but others are baked into the board’s design. Layout, mounting style, and connection behavior are not minor details once the keyboard is on your desk every day.
Practical alternatives if a prebuilt board is not the right fit
If you are not fully convinced, there are a few sensible alternatives.
Standard office keyboards can still be the better choice if you only need something dependable and quiet. Not every user benefits from mechanical switches.
Low-profile mechanical keyboards may suit people who want less travel and a slimmer shape, especially if they are used to laptop-style typing.
Entry-level custom kits are worth considering if you want to learn the hobby gradually and are willing to spend time on assembly and tuning.
The best alternative depends on whether your priority is convenience, comfort, sound, portability, or personalization. There is no universal winner.
